Since our inception in Mananthavady on May 19, 1977, by His Grace Mar Jacob Thoomkuzhy, Archbishop Emeritus of Trissur, and then Bishop of Mananthavady, we have grown into a well-known organization dedicated to social development. We were canonically erected on September 8, 1986, and elevated to a major Archibiscopal status on March 25, 2006 on the feast of Annunciation to our Blessed Virgin Mary. In response, Home of Love Charitable Society has established a Rehabilitation Centre for the elderly and mentally challenged, offering comprehensive support and opportunities for a fulfilling life. Our organization is renowned for its commitment to social service. We operate an old age home and various training programs for the mentally challenged and social workers. Home of Love Charitable Society is a registered society under the Societies Registration Act, XXI of 1960 (S.NO.446/2006) by the District Registrar (GL), Kozhikode District, with a license from the Municipal Corporation, Kozhikode, to construct and run a home for the Old & Destitute.
